Investigative Reports is an American documentary which aired on A&E. The series premiered on July 10, 1992.
A long-running, Emmy-winning documentary series that explores foreign and domestic stories, including pieces that range from criminal cases to cultural trends. Host Bill Kurtis introduces segments and provides narration. Notable broadcasts have included `The Plague Monkeys,' a report on the Ebola virus; and `Uncle Ho and Uncle Sam,' about America's WWII alliance with Ho Chi Minh. `Investigative Reports' expanded to five nights in 1999, and in 2002 spun off `Cold Case Files.'
